Michelle Ryan has spoken out for the first time since the BBC confirmed that her character Zoe Slater will be written out of EastEnders later this year.

The 42-year-old actress, who returned to the soap in 2025 after two decades away, posted on Instagram on Sunday to hint at what lies ahead for her professionally.


“Working on my next project this summer and looking forward to sharing more soon,” she wrote.

“It’s been a busy stretch, so if you’ve written and are still waiting on a reply they’re on the way.”

Sources say Ms Ryan’s final scenes were filmed in July, with her departure set to air in the coming months.

A spokeswoman for EastEnders said: “We can confirm Zoe Slater will be departing EastEnders later this year. We wish Michelle Ryan all the best for the future.”

Fans flooded the comments section of her post with heartfelt messages.

“To wait 20 years to finally have you back, to now read that announcement of THE Zoe Slater is potentially being killed off is so sad,” one fan penned.

Another called Zoe “an iconic character” who “deserves so much better.”

“Really disappointed that Zoe is being killed off “, a third added.

A source told The Sun: “Michelle’s long-awaited return has been somewhat flat and lacklustre.

“There’s been a backlash about her comeback, leaving some fans disappointed with her on-screen presence.”

The source added: “There has been some disappointment backstage that the return was short-lived.”

The character’s second stint included a stalking ordeal, a wrongful murder conviction and long-lost child drama, yet the storylines failed to land with many viewers.

Prior to Zoe’s on-screen reappearance, executive producer Ben Wadey had spoken ambitiously about mining two decades of untold history between mother and daughter.

“Since Zoe left, we know their relationship deteriorated until Zoe cut ties completely,” he said.

“I’ve always been fascinated as to why, especially as they left on good terms.”

As Zoe prepares to bow out, the BBC has announced that a fresh clan will be arriving in Albert Square.

The Hawkins family, who are estranged relatives of existing character Nicola Mitchell, will bring longstanding grudges and tangled family history to Walford.

Audiences already know that Nicola has maintained a deliberate distance from her relatives, and their arrival promises to reopen old wounds.

Mr Wadey expressed his excitement about the newcomers, describing them as “a fantastic addition to Walford.”

He added: “While the family share a fierce loyalty to one another, decades of complicated history and Nicola’s estrangement from them has left fractures within the family that are far from healed.

“We’re all very excited for what we have planned for the family, and we can’t wait for the audience to meet them.”
